CAS 142457-00-9
:AMTHAMINE DIHYDROBROMIDE

Formula:C6H13Br2N3S
InChI:InChI=1/C6H11N3S.2BrH/c1-4-5(2-3-7)10-6(8)9-4;;/h2-3,7H2,1H3,(H2,8,9);2*1H
SMILES:Cc1c(CCN)sc(=N)[nH]1.Br.Br
Synonyms:- 5-Thiazoleethanamine, 2-amino-4-methyl-
- 2-Amino-5-(2-aminoethyl)-4-methylthiazole
- 5-(2-Aminoethyl)-4-Methyl-1,3-Thiazol-2-Amine
- 5-(2-Aminoethyl)-4-Methyl-1,3-Thiazol-2-Amine Dihydrobromide
